After your breakfast at 08:30 AM,depart with your local guide for orientation tour, which visits the highlights of the capital. Visit Wat Sisaket, the oldest original temple in Vientiane. Wat Sisaket features remarkable frescoes and over 6,000 Buddha images. Nearby is Haw Phra Kaew, once the royal temple of Lao monarchy. The main structure originally housed the famous Emerald Buddha that now resides in Bangkok. Continue to visit Wat Si Muang, the site of the lák méuang (city pillar), which is considered the home of the guardian spirit of Vientiane. The large sǐm ordination hall was built during the reign of King Seththathirath in 1565 and it’s destroyed in 1828 and rebuilt in 1915 was constructed around the lák méuang, and consists of two halls. It is holy temple where buddhist people like to come to pray for monk blessing which it is customary ritual to receive personal blessing by the monk chanting and sprinkle holy water on over your head with typing a white cotton thread(saisin) around the wrist for bring the good luck, good health, good business, prosperity and longevity.

Another famous Vientiane landmark is the Phra That Luang stupa. King Sethtathirat built this great sacred stupa in 1566, considered the national symbol. The original stupa was said to contain relics of Lord Buddha. Afterwards take a visit Patouxai, the victory gate also known as Anousavari.Constructed in 1958, its architecture is inspired by the Arc of Triumph in Paris. Afterwards continue on driving to Ban Khuen Salt(Salt Village) to explore local people make the salt and the salt is made by traditionally with the supports of simple tools. Firstly,the water is pumped from below the ground into tanks which are heated by firewood in about 2 or 3 hours. After that they leave salt for drying about 24 hours before they’re packing it to be sole through the whole country of Laos. Especially, this is quite hard processing for woman to play the important role in controlling the heat and stirring the salt tanks until it’s completing to consume.

(It’s surrounded by thickly forested mountains and situated at the confluence of the Khan and Mekong Rivers, Luang Prabang has a tranquil, old world charm rarely found in Asia today. This fascinating town was the capital of the Lane Xang (million elephants) Kingdom until the mid-sixteenth century.  In colonial times it served as a provincial headquarters of the north.The legacy of the European presence here-well preserved French architecture and careful street planning-has blended delightfully with more than 30 gilded Buddhist temples to create a town rich in good atmosphere and history.Luang Prabang is perhaps the best-preserved traditional city in South East Asia. In 1995 UNESCO voted Luang Prabang as a World Heritage City).

This evening at 18:30 PM will transfer out with your local guide to meet senor people and Shaman to be honest to do BaciCeremony for you as well as to celebrate a special event, whether a marriage, a homecoming, one of the annual festivals and welcome a baby birth, A mother is given a baci after she has recovered form a birth, the sick are given bacis to facilitate a cure, officials are honored by bacis, and novice,monks are wished luck with a baci before entering the temple. The Baci ceremony can take place any day of the week and all year long, preferably before noon or before sunset. The term more commonly used is su kwan, which means “calling of the soul”.
